BNY Mellon Strategic Municipals has a beta of 0.6, suggesting that its stock price is 40%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Central Securities has a beta of 0.84, suggesting that its stock price is 16% less volatile than the S&P 500. Is LEO or CET a better dividend stock? BNY Mellon Strategic Municipals pays an annual dividend of $0.13 per share and has a dividend yield of 2.2%. Central Securities pays an annual dividend of $2.30 per share and has a dividend yield of 4.7%. Is LEO or CET more profitable?
